RPA(Robotic Process Automation)란?
RPA(Robotic Process Automation)는 소프트웨어 로봇을 사용하여 기업의 업무 프로세스를 자동으로 처리하는 기술을 말합니다. RPA는 소프트웨어 기술로, 프론트 및 백오피스 프로세스를 자동화하는 것을 목적으로 하며 전통적인 IT 개발 방식보다 더 빠르고 비용 효율적으로 업무를 자동화할 수 있습니다.
인간이 컴퓨터를 조작하고 애플리케이션을 사용하며 프로세스를 수행하는 방식을 모방하며 이를 통해 RPA는 데스크톱 기반 애플리케이션에서 많은 양의 수작업을 자동화하여 반복적이고 일상적인 작업을 줄여 기업의 효율성과 생산성을 높이고 직원의 부담을 줄여주는 것이 목적입니다.
RPA 소프트웨어 로봇은 일상적인 업무 작업을 수행하기 위해 인공 지능 및 기계 학습 알고리즘을 사용합니다. 이러한 알고리즘을 사용하여 로봇은 데이터를 수집하고 분석하며, 작업을 완료하기 위해 필요한 정보를 추출합니다.
RPA의 사용 분야
RPA는 대부분의 업계에서 사용되며, 주로 다음과 같은 분야에서 사용됩니다.
금융 서비스: 금융 서비스 업계에서는 RPA를 사용하여 업무 처리 및 거래 처리를 자동화합니다. 예를 들어, 금융 거래 처리, 고객 신청 처리, 고객 지원 및 예산 관리를 자동화할 수 있습니다.
제조 및 생산: 제조 및 생산 분야에서는 RPA를 사용하여 제품 조립, 검사 및 포장과 같은 작업을 자동화합니다. 의료 서비스: 의료 서비스 분야에서는 RPA를 사용하여 환자 진료 정보 관리, 약물 관리, 환자 예약 및 예방 점검을 자동화합니다.
고객 서비스: 고객 서비스 분야에서는 RPA를 사용하여 고객 문의 처리, 뉴스 레터 발송 및 고객 지원을 자동화할 수 있습니다. RPA를 사용하면 업무 처리 시간을 단축하고, 오류를 최소화하며, 업무 처리 비용을 절감할 수 있습니다. 또한, 인력 부족으로 인한 업무 지연을 방지할 수 있습니다. 따라서, RPA는 기업이 업무 프로세스를 효과적으로 관리할 수 있도록 도와줍니다.
RPA의 응용분야
RPA는 매우 다양한 방식으로 사용됩니다. 일부 기업은 RPA를 단순히 업무 처리 자동화에 사용하고, 다른 기업은 RPA를 확장하여 비즈니스 프로세스 자동화, 데이터 분석 및 예측, 머신 러닝 및 인공 지능과 통합하는 등의 기능을 추가할 수 있습니다. RPA 소프트웨어 로봇은 다양한 시스템 및 애플리케이션과 통합될 수 있습니다.
예를 들어, ERP(Enterprise Resource Planning) 시스템, CRM(Customer Relationship Management) 시스템, CMS(Content Management System) 시스템 및 웹 애플리케이션과 통합될 수 있습니다. 이러한 시스템 및 애플리케이션과의 통합을 통해 RPA는 다양한 업무 처리 작업을 수행할 수 있습니다.
RPA는 자동화할 수 있는 업무 작업의 범위에 제한이 없습니다. RPA 소프트웨어 로봇은 키보드 및 마우스를 사용하여 작업을 수행할 수 있으며, OCR(Optical Character Recognition) 및 이미지 인식과 같은 기술을 사용하여 문서 처리 및 데이터 추출 작업을 수행할 수도 있습니다.
또한, RPA는 다양한 언어로 작성될 수 있으며, 다양한 플랫폼에서 실행될 수 있습니다. 대부분의 RPA 소프트웨어는 비주얼 프로그래밍 언어를 사용하여 프로그램을 작성할 수 있으며, 다양한 운영 체제 및 클라우드 플랫폼에서 실행될 수 있습니다.
RPA 기술의 미래
RPA는 고도화된 기술 발전과 함께 계속해서 발전하고 있습니다. 예를 들어, RPA와 머신 러닝, 인공 지능 및 자연어 처리와 같은 기술을 결합하여 자동화 작업의 정확도와 효율성을 높일 수 있습니다. 또한, RPA는 블록체인과 같은 기술과 결합하여 보안 및 데이터 관리를 강화할 수도 있습니다.
RPA는 현재 많은 기업에서 사용되고 있으며, 미래에도 그 사용이 계속 확대될 것으로 예상됩니다. RPA를 사용하여 인력이 반복적인 작업에서 해방되어 더 중요한 업무에 집중할 수 있도록 하는 등 인력과 비즈니스 프로세스의 최적화에도 기여하고 있습니다. 앞으로 RPA는 인공 지능, 머신 러닝, 자연어 처리 등의 기술과 결합하여 더욱 높은 수준의 자동화 작업을 수행할 수 있을 것으로 예상됩니다.
예를 들어 RPA를 사용하여 금융 업무나 고객 상담 업무와 같은 분야에서는 인공 지능 기술을 활용하여 더욱 정확하고 효율적인 업무 처리가 가능할 것입니다. 또한, RPA는 새로운 비즈니스 모델의 출현과 함께 기업의 디지털 전환에도 큰 역할을 할 것입니다. RPA를 사용하여 프로세스 자동화 및 최적화를 수행하면 기업은 더욱 빠른 변화와 혁신을 이룰 수 있으며, 이를 통해 경쟁력을 유지하고 확대할 수 있을 것입니다.
하지만, RPA는 여전히 기술적 한계와 인력 교육 및 관리 등의 문제도 존재합니다. 따라서 RPA를 성공적으로 도입하고 활용하기 위해서는 이러한 문제들을 극복할 수 있는 전략적인 계획과 충분한 지원이 필요할 것입니다.
'용어 사전' 카테고리의 다른 글
IPoE(IP over Ethernet)란? (0) | 2023.05.07 |
---|---|
NGN(Next-Generation Network)이란? (0) | 2023.05.07 |
LTE-M(Long Term Evolution for Machines)이란? (0) | 2023.04.27 |
LPWA(Low Power Wide Area)란? (0) | 2023.04.27 |
싱귤래리티(Singularity)란? (0) | 2023.04.26 |
5G란? (0) | 2023.04.26 |
디지털 트랜스포메이션(Digital Transformation, DX)이란? (0) | 2023.04.26 |
양자 컴퓨터(Quantum Computing)란? (0) | 2023.04.25 |